The volume of a box is 80 cubic feet with length x-3 and width x-1 and height x+5. What are the possible values of x? What are t
Kryger [21]

Answer:

  • the only possible value of x is 5
  • the dimensions are 2 × 4 × 10

Step-by-step explanation:

The cubic equation ...

  (x -3)(x -1)(x +5) = 80

has one real root: x = 5. Using that value for x, the dimensions become ...

  length = 5 - 3 = 2

  width = 5 - 1 = 4

  height = 5 + 5 = 10

The dimensions are (length, width, height) = (2, 4, 10).

_____

We cannot tell the thrust of the problem, since it has only one solution. Perhaps you're supposed to write the cubic in standard form and use the <em>Rational Root theorem</em> to find <em>possible values of x</em>. That form can be found to be ...

  (x -3)(x -1)(x +5) -80 = 0

  x³ +x² -17x -65 = 0

Descartes' rule of signs tells you there is one positive real root. The rational root theorem tells you possible rational roots are factors of 65:

  1, 5, 13, 65

We know that x must be greater than 3 (so all dimensions are positive). Thus <em>possible values of x are 5, 13, 65</em>, and we're pretty sure that 65 is way too large.
